I’ve been photographing shelter pets for Longmont Humane Society for 16 years and still feel the same passion now as I did when I started.
Good quality photos of shelter animals show adopters the great personalities and potential of the animals in waiting. Good photos also help to minimize the negative connotation that many people have when they think of an animal shelter. Seeing good photographs of shelter pets helps people see that that particular shelter can be a good place to visit. In other words, continually seeing good quality images on shelter websites and social channels shows the public that this shelter is actually a good place, not a sad and depressing place.
A good quality photo can get a homeless pet adopted up to 60% faster. And, that is really important to a shelter pet.
